Output 745503c94f713fb1ff838161d84f4a561d40a065ddb212bda87779e0990fab5e:5

value
36890091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2644ba9cdf554fe5017f3f006e4ededd616f508b OP_EQUAL
address
MBPWF6FWgitxXjSmHpKb9Rh1ZCQVmNpc32
transaction
745503c94f713fb1ff838161d84f4a561d40a065ddb212bda87779e0990fab5e
spent
true